When you make your living as a freelance writer, you can come across some pretty weird gigs.
You know that you can earn money writing, but you don't have experience in business, finance or technology, so you think that getting paid for writing stuff doesn't apply to you.
All you have to do is look a bit harder, and you can get paid for writing about some pretty odd stuff.
Here are some gigs, and what they paid, to whet your enthusiasm.
- Ghostwriting love letters or break-up letters. $5 - $15
- Writing emails for a busy CEO to his wife to maintain the relationship. $300 per email
- Write for niche websites - blind ponies, gemstone mines, knives. The gemstone mines paid $800 per article.
- Oddball news reports. $200 - $400 per piece.
- Product descriptions for figurines for a website. $25 each.
- 200 words for an Adult website. $30.
- Online copywriting for a Naked Sushi Event organiser. $200 each.
- Descriptions for Adult movies in 140 characters for Twitter. Paid to watch porn, who would have thought.
You'll find these gigs on sites like Fiverr, Freelancer, Upwork, Craig's list etc. Search for freelance writing gigs for more inspiration.
